Abstract
The utility model discloses a hand-pressing type variable-speed rotary mop, which comprises a hand-pressing mop rod and a rotary mop, wherein the rotary mop comprises a mop connecting head (11), a mop disc (12), a cotton yarn fixing disc (13), a star gear (14), a center gear (15) and a large toothed disc (16), the cotton yarn fixing disc (13) is fixedly arranged on the mop disc (12), a connecting shaft arranged at the upper part of the center gear (15) penetrates through a center hole in the mop disc (12), is inserted into the mop connecting head (11) and is connected with the hand-pressing mop rod, the star gear (14) is rotatably arranged on the mop disc (12), the large toothed disc (16) is rotatably arranged on a tray (20) of the center gear (15) and is covered on the star gear (14), the inner circle of the star gear (14) is engaged with the center gear (15), the outer circle of the star gear (14) is engaged with the large toothed disc (16), and the bottom of the large toothed disc (16) is fixedly provided with a cleaning connecting seat (19). By the adoption of the structure, the rotary mop has the advantages that the structure is simple, the rotary mop is flexible and convenient in use, rotation is stable, two types of rotation speeds can be outputted according to cleaning and dewatering requirements, and the like.

The specific embodiment
Illustrated in figures 1 and 2, specific embodiments for a kind of hand rotary mop of the utility model, it comprises the hand mop rod, rotary mop, described hand mop rod comprises handle 1, last mop rod 2, driving mechanism 3, sheath 4, connecting rod 5, tighten overcoat 6, cover 7 in tightening, following mop rod 8, tighten cover 9, Connection Block 10, handle 1 is fixed on the mop rod 2, fixedly connected by sheath 4 between last mop rod 2 and the connecting rod 5, be rotatably connected by tightening interior cover 7 and tightening overcoat 6 between following mop rod 8 and the connecting rod 5, Connection Block 10 is fixed with following mop rod 8 by tightening cover 9, and last mop rod 2 drives mop rod 8 one-directional rotation down by driving mechanism 3.Described rotary mop comprises mop connector 11, mop dish 12, cotton yarn fixed disk 13, spider gear 14, central gear 15, large fluted disc 16, cotton yarn fixed disk 13 is fixed on the mop dish 12, the connecting axle on central gear 15 tops passes mop dish 12 centre bores insertion mop connector 11 and together is connected with the hand mop rod, three uniform spider gears 14 are arranged on the mop dish 12 rotationally, large fluted disc 16 is arranged on the pallet 20 of central gear 15 rotationally and covers on the spider gear 14, can prevent that cotton yarn from curling up on spider gear 14, the inner ring of spider gear 14 and central gear 15 engagements, outer ring and large fluted disc 16 engagements, the Connection Block 19 of cleaning is fixedly arranged at the bottom of large fluted disc 16.When mop cleans, the utility model also comprises cleaning and positioning apparatus, this positioner comprises cleaning connector 17 and unilateral bearing 18, but the rotating shaft of cleaning connector 17 is arranged on the washing bucket by unilateral bearing 18 one-directional rotation ground, and cleaning connector 17 is provided with and cleans Connection Block 19 latch that matches.
The utility model course of work is as follows: when rotary mop cleans, the cleaning Connection Block 19 of the bottom of large fluted disc 16 cooperates with cleaning connector 17, when pressing the hand mop rod, last mop rod 2 drives mop rod 8 rotations down by the fried dough twist bar of driving mechanism 3, following mop rod 8 drives central gear 15 rotations by Connection Block 10 and mop connector 11, large fluted disc 16 is owing to the effect of unilateral bearing 18 can not be rotated, central gear 15 drives spider gear 14, spider gear 14 slows down when large fluted disc 16 rotates and drives mop dish 12 and 13 rotations of cotton yarn fixed disk, thereby realize the mop cleaning function, feel is light during cleaning, rotate flexibly, speed is moderate.
When rotary mop dewaters, central gear 15 cooperates with the dehydration basket center sub, mop dish 12 and the cotton yarn that is fixed on cotton yarn fixed disk 13 are placed on the dehydration basket, when pressing the hand mop rod, last mop rod 2 drives mop rod 8 rotations down by the fried dough twist bar of driving mechanism 3, and following mop rod 8 drives central gear 15 rotations by Connection Block 10, and central gear 15 drives dehydration basket fast, dehydration basket drives mop dish 12 and the dehydration of cotton yarn fast rotational, can realize mop fast dewatering function equally.
